How do you cook a beef roast in a ninja?
Preheat the Ninja Foodi on Broil with the rack in the low position inside the inner pot for 10 minutes. Broil the roast beef on the rack in the low position for 25 minutes. Turn the Ninja Foodi off and keep the lid closed for 25 minutes. See notes if you want your meat cooked to a different temperature.

How long does it take to pressure cook beef?
As a general rule, when cooking beef roasts in a pressure cooker, assume 20 minutes of cook time for every pound of meat.
How do I pressure cook a roast?
Sear roast on all sides in hot oil until browned; season with salt, onion powder, and pepper. Pour in beef broth and Worcestershire sauce, add onion, and seal the lid. Bring the cooker up to full pressure. Reduce heat to low, maintaining full pressure, and cook for 30 minutes.

How do you cook a roast in a Ninja Foodi grill?
When the grill is preheated and says to add meat, place the chuck roast in the inner pan of the grill. You should hear it sizzle. Close the lid and increase the grill setting to the max grill (510℉/265℃) for 5 minutes. Flip the meat over and grill another 5 minutes.

What is the difference between roast and bake on Ninja Foodi grill?
The bake/roast function on the Ninja Foodi is one of the buttons that we can select when choosing which function to use when cooking. Throughout this article, I will be referring to this function as simply the bake function, but there is no difference between bake or roast in the Ninja Foodi.
Is broil the same as roast?
Roasting uses the same all-over heat as baking but at higher temperatures. Broiling uses top-down heat at high and extra-high temperatures to brown or crisp the top of food.

Can you overcook a roast in a pressure cooker?
Can You Overcook Meat in a Pressure Cooker? The short answer is yes. And, unfortunately, once you overcook a piece of meat in the pressure cooker, there’s no going back. All you’ll have left will be a heap of dry, crunchy fibers with no taste.
